DeepSeek R1

DeepSeek R1

DeepSeek R1 / V3

An open-source reasoning model offering o1-tier logic at a fraction of the cost.

Key Strengths
  • Incredible reasoning chain for math, physics, logic, and coding
  • Open-weights architecture allows local, private execution
  • Exceedingly cheap API rates that disrupted commercial AI pricing
Limitations
  • No native multimodal features (cannot generate images or process video directly)
  • Frequent server congestion and network timeouts during peak times
  • Basic interface lacks advanced features like Claude's Artifacts

ChatGPT

ChatGPT

OpenAI ChatGPT

The industry-standard multimodal AI platform with voice, reasoning, and image capabilities.

Key Strengths
  • Advanced voice and visual synthesis (DALL-E 3 & Advanced Voice Mode)
  • Deep reasoning capability with specialized o1 and o3-mini models
  • Massive third-party ecosystem and thousands of Custom GPTs
Limitations
  • Writing tone can feel formulaic or preachy without custom instructions
  • Daily rate limits on advanced reasoning models can disrupt heavy workflows
  • Smaller context window than Google's Gemini models

Real-World Task Diagnostic

Conducted in our testing environments. Model configurations: default cloud API.

Test ID: TX-2026

Workflow Scenario: We evaluated both utilities by loading them with a custom logical problem. Below is the exact prompt configuration used in this test:

Instruction-Following Prompt Write a B2B product description for a data dashboard, format it as nested bullet points, list 3 clear cost advantages, and ensure it excludes generic marketing buzzwords like "robust" or "cutting-edge".

We compared the tools using standard professional workflows. During our testing sessions, we observed distinct behavioral patterns. DeepSeek R1 followed all instructions correctly, excluding the banned marketing terms and using a direct, B2B-friendly writing tone.

On the other hand, ChatGPT wrote a engaging description, but slipped in the word "robust" in the second paragraph, failing the negative constraint. This trial highlights a common difference: DeepSeek R1 handles negative constraints and strict instruction sets with fewer errors, while ChatGPT is better suited for open-ended creative tasks.

Workflow Speed

Comparing model query latencies and rendering speeds on high-load questions.

DeepSeek R1 DeepSeek R1 Evaluation

Reasoning chains introduce a 15-45 second processing time. Server congestion causes frequent timeouts.

Pros
  • Deep thinking steps
  • Detailed logical outcomes
Cons
  • High latency and connection errors
ChatGPT ChatGPT Evaluation

GPT-4o mini is nearly instant. Reasoning models (o1/o3-mini) introduce a 5-15 second thinking delay before responding.

Pros
  • Rapid basic replies
  • Low latency on light tasks
Cons
  • Reasoning delay can disrupt flow

Workflow Speed Verdict

For quick, real-time query responses, ChatGPT is the faster engine, while DeepSeek R1 is built for more deliberate, deep processing.
